Crucial legislation you cannot ignore as a Gloucester business

UK businesses seeking emergency lighting installation in Gloucester must comply with several key regulations, though specific requirements can vary based on your building type, occupancy levels, and business activities.

Relevant legislation includes:

  • The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005 – Requires adequate emergency lighting for safe evacuation and mandates regular testing and maintenance
  • The Building Regulations 2010 (specifically Part B) – Sets standards for emergency lighting design and installation in different types of buildings
  • The Health and Safety at Work Act 1974 – Establishes the fundamental requirement for employers to guarantee workplace safety, including adequate emergency lighting

Types of Emergency Lighting available

 

Selecting the right emergency lighting system plays a crucial role in ensuring your premises’ safety and compliance with regulations.

We’ll help you understand the main emergency light types available for your business.

Our lighting system options include:

  • Maintained Emergency Lights – Always illuminated and perfect for spaces requiring constant lighting like theatres and hospitals
  • Non-Maintained Lights – Activate only during power failures, ideal for offices and warehouses
  • Combined Emergency Lights – Feature both maintained and non-maintained functions
  • Open Area Lighting – Illuminates large spaces for safe evacuation
  • Escape Route Lighting – Guides occupants to exit points during emergencies

Frequently Asked Questions

How Long Does a Typical Emergency Lighting Installation Take to Complete?

Most emergency lighting installations typically take 1-2 days for standard projects, though the installation timeline varies with project complexity. We’ll work efficiently around your schedule to minimise disruption while ensuring your safety system is properly installed.

What Is the Average Lifespan of Emergency Lighting Batteries?

We recommend replacing emergency lighting batteries every 3-4 years as part of regular battery maintenance. However, the replacement schedule should be based on specific system usage patterns and routine testing results.

Can Emergency Lights Be Tested Remotely Through a Central Monitoring System?

Yes, emergency lights can be tested remotely through advanced central monitoring systems. These systems enable performance checks, diagnostic testing, and issue identification from a centralised location. The technology allows facilities to conduct required safety inspections without the need for physical access to each lighting unit. Remote monitoring provides real-time status updates, battery health information, and immediate alerts if any units malfunction.

Are Wireless Emergency Lighting Systems as Reliable as Hardwired Installations?

Wireless systems offer reliability comparable to hardwired installations while providing easier installation benefits. However, a hybrid approach incorporating both wireless and hardwired components in critical areas creates enhanced protection levels.
